ObjectivesThe phenomenon of doping is rarely researched in Paralympic sport, especially from the coach perspective. This study responds directly to this gap in research by exploring coaches' doping-related perceptions, knowledge, and opinions of the current anti-doping system in order to inform future interventions specific to disabled elite sport contexts.MethodEleven coaches from Germany (n = 6) and the UK (n = 5) working across physiological (n = 7) and skill-based (n = 4) sport disciplines at an elite level (Paralympic, n = 10 and World Championship, n = 1) took part in semi-structured interviews. Data were analysed using abductive reflexive thematic analysis (Braun & Clarke, 2019a).FindingsFour themes were developed to capture the coaches’ perspectives. The first represents coaches’ perception that doping is an issue in Paralympic sport. The second theme shows that risk factors to dope are typically multiple and intertwined, stemming especially from financial incentives and pressure to win. Theme three captures coaches' opinion of differences in testing and education across countries due to budget, resource, or infrastructure issues. Finally, data showed that coaches prefer to refer responsibility for doping prevention to their national anti-doping organisation, rather than taking on personal responsibility for anti-doping efforts.ConclusionsAccording to the interviewed coaches, doping has the potential to be a big issue in disabled elite sport. The main risk factors of money and pressure to win (earn prize money or funding/sponsorship) are knitted together and can be additionally impacted (negatively) by a nation’s sporting system. These factors should be addressed by thinking both on an individual level (e.g., support dual careers) and a structural/policy level (e.g., aim to have minimum standards to level the global inconsistent anti-doping systems, including anti-doping education/testing). Sentiment Analysis is considered as an important research field in text mining, and is significant in recommendation systems and e-learning environments. This research proposes a new methodology of e-learning hybrid Recommendation System Based on Sentiment Analysis (RSBSA) by leveraging tailored Natural Language Processing (NLP) and Convolutional Neural Network (CNN) techniques, to recommend appropriate e-learning materials based on learner’s preferences. Integration is done on fine-grained sentiment analysis models, to classify text reviews of e-content posted on e-learning platform. Two enhanced language models based on ‘Continuous Bag of Word’ and ‘Skip-Gram’ are introduced. Moreover, three resilient language models based on the hybrid language techniques are developed to produce a superior vocabulary representation. These models were trained using various CNN models to predict ratings of resources from online reviews provided by learners. To accomplish this, a customizable dataset ‘ABHR-1′ is used, which is derived from e-content' reviews with corresponding ratings labeled [1–5]. The proposed models are evaluated and tested using ABHR-1 and two public datasets. According to the simulation results, Multiplication-Several-Channels-CNN model outperformed other models with an accuracy of 90.37 % for fine-grained sentiment classification on 5 discrete classes and the empirical results are compared. 相似文献

An on-bike warning system has great potential to increase safety of cyclists. For an effective warning system, the implementation of warning signals is fundamental. However, more knowledge about the cyclist specific design of warnings and the influence of warnings on the cyclist is needed. To analyze the benefit of warnings in conflicts and the reaction pattern of cyclists we conducted a test-track experiment. We evaluated the data of 62 participants who were divided into three warning groups (between-subjects) and encountered different situations (within-subjects). The warning groups either received acoustic, vibro-tactile or no warnings. The situation variable consisted of three conflicts and two false warnings in the groups with warnings.We measured significantly shorter reaction times of persons who received acoustic and vibro-tactile warnings compared to the persons without warning. Furthermore, acoustic warnings led to shorter reaction times compared to vibro-tactile warnings. The reaction pattern was described by different bicycle dynamics variables. It was mostly influenced by the situation and rarely by the warning group. Based on the velocity curves and reaction times we identified learning effects describing how the warned participants adopted the warning system over the five situations.These findings indicate that a warning system offers great safety benefits to cyclists. Based on the current results, acoustic warnings are recommended when an urgent reaction is required. 相似文献

System Justification Theory posits that individuals are less prone to engage in radical action against a system on which they depend. In the present research, we investigated how the association between system-justifying tendencies and radical intentions is moderated by individuals' orientation towards power differentials, namely their “power distance.” A stronger power distance orientation implies that individuals perceive power differentials as a fixed feature of society, curtailing prospects for change. We hypothesized that, at lower levels of power distance orientation, system-justification tendencies would be associated with reduced radical intentions. We contend this will occur because individuals feel dependent on a system perceived as malleable (dependency hypothesis). Conversely, at higher levels of power distance orientation, we expected system-justification tendencies to be associated with stronger radical intentions. We argue that this effect reflects the rejection of dependency on a system perceived as fixed (counterdependency hypothesis). This dependency-counterdependency dynamic was tested using a multigroup latent structural equation model and samples from four countries (NTotal = 2,502), South Korea, Italy, the United Kingdom, and the United States. Results were consistent with the hypothesized dynamic across all countries. Theoretical implications of the findings, limitations, and future research directions are discussed. 相似文献

Genetics are undoubtedly implicated in the ontogenesis of laterality. Nonetheless, environmental factors, such as the intrauterine environment, may also play a role in the development of functional and behavioral lateralization. The aim of this study was to test the Left-Otolithic Dominance Theory (LODT; Previc, 1991) by investigating a hypothetical developmental pattern where it is assumed that a breech presentation, which is putatively associated with a dysfunctional and weakly lateralized vestibular system, can lead to weak handedness and atypical development associated with language and motor difficulties. We used the ALSPAC cohort of children from 7 to 10 years of age to conduct our investigation. Our results failed to show an association between the vestibular system and fetal presentation, nor any influence of the latter on hand preference, hand performance, or language and motor development. Bayesian statistical analyses supported these findings. Contrary to our LODT-derived hypotheses, this study offers evidence that fetal presentation does not influence the vestibular system's lateralization and seems to be a poor indicator for handedness. Nonetheless, we found that another non-genetic factor, prematurity, could lead to atypical development of handedness. 相似文献

The ability to perceive approximate numerosity is present in many animal species, and emerges early in human infants. Later in life, it is moderately heritable and associated with mathematical abilities, but the etiology of the Approximate Number System (ANS) and its degree of independence from other cognitive abilities in infancy is unknown. Here, we assessed the phenotypic specificity as well as the influence of genetic and environmental factors on the ANS in a sample of 5-month-old twins (N = 514). We found a small-to-moderate but statistically significant effect of genetic factors on ANS acuity (heritability = 0.18, 95% CI: 0.02, 0.33), but only when differences in numerosity were relatively large (1:4 ratio). Non-verbal ability assessed with the Mullen Scales of Early Learning (MSEL) was found to be heritable (0.47; 95% CI: 0.34, 0.57) and the phenotypic association between ANS acuity and non-verbal ability performance was close to zero. Similarly, we found no association between ANS acuity and general attention during the task. An unexpected weak but statistically significant negative association between ANS acuity and scores on the receptive language scale of the MSEL was found. These results suggest that early ANS function may be largely independent from other aspects of non-verbal development. Further, variability in ANS in infancy seems to, to some extent, reflect genotypic differences in the population.

Preverbal infants spontaneously represent the number of objects in collections. Is this ‘sense of number’ (also referred to as Approximate Number System, ANS) part of the cognitive foundations of mathematical skills? Multiple studies reported a correlation between the ANS and mathematical achievement in children. However, some have suggested that such correlation might be mediated by general-purpose inhibitory skills. We addressed the question using a longitudinal approach: we tested the ANS of 60 12 months old infants and, when they were 4 years old (final N = 40), their symbolic math achievement as well as general intelligence and inhibitory skills. Results showed that the ANS at 12 months is a specific predictor of later maths skills independent from general intelligence or inhibitory skills. The correlation between ANS and maths persists when both abilities are measured at four years. These results confirm that the ANS has an early, specific and longstanding relation with mathematical abilities in childhood.

System justification and meritocratic beliefs legitimize the status quo of economic, social, and political arrangements, and may correlate with favourable evaluations of governments' performance during the COVID-19 pandemic. This study furthers research on this topic by examining (1) the cultural value antecedents of system justification and meritocratic beliefs, and (2) the differential effects of these on attitudes toward ingroups and outgroups from an intergroup perspective. The results show that collectivist values positively predict system justification and meritocratic beliefs, whereas a similar effect was not observed for individualist values. As hypothesized, system justification motivation was positively associated with favourable evaluation of the Chinese government (an ingroup). By contrast, system justification and meritocratic beliefs were negatively associated with evaluation of the American government (an outgroup). We discussed the implications for understandings of the cultural value bases of system justification and meritocratic beliefs, and the relevance of the lens of intergroup relations in studying those beliefs. 相似文献

The design of recommendation strategies in the adaptive learning systems focuses on utilizing currently available information to provide learners with individual-specific learning instructions. As a critical motivate for human behaviours, curiosity is essentially the drive to explore knowledge and seek information. In a psychologically inspired view, we propose a curiosity-driven recommendation policy within the reinforcement learning framework, allowing for an efficient and enjoyable personalized learning path. Specifically, a curiosity reward from a well-designed predictive model is generated to model one's familiarity with the knowledge space. Given such curiosity rewards, we apply the actor–critic method to approximate the policy directly through neural networks. Numerical analyses with a large continuous knowledge state space and concrete learning scenarios are provided to further demonstrate the efficiency of the proposed method. 相似文献

Two cognitive biases might partially account for public support of the ineffective AMBER Alert system. Hindsight bias is a cognitive error in which people with outcome knowledge overestimate the likelihood that this particular outcome would occur; outcome bias is an error made in evaluating the quality of a decision once the outcome is known. Two experiments assessed whether hindsight and outcome bias occur in child abduction scenarios. Study 1 was a pre/posttest experiment that examined whether hindsight bias occurs in situations in which the identity of the abductor (stranger or parent) is manipulated between groups, and all participants are told the child was killed. Study 2, a between-subjects experiment, examined whether hindsight and outcome biases occur in situations in which no AMBER Alert was issued (because the situation did not meet the legal requirements to issue an Alert), and manipulated the identity of the abductor and the outcome (child safely returned, killed, or not outcome provided). Hindsight and outcome biases occurred in both studies, given the correct set of circumstances. Abductor identity also impacted outcome estimates. Results from the two studies indicate that hindsight and outcome bias occur, but this is dependent on the outcome (child killed, child returned safely, no outcome provided) and the identity of the abductor (stranger, dangerous parent, non-dangerous parent). Limitations and future directions are discussed. 相似文献
